What actually sets value in Barcley Estates 2Nd Add is age and condition spread, not floor plan or amenity package. With a build range stretching from 1906 to 2024 and a median year built of 1957, you're looking at a mix of older housing stock alongside newer infill or rebuilds, which means two homes on the same block can price very differently based on how much has been updated.
A homestead share of just over 71% tells you this is a community with a real base of long-term owners rather than a rotating rental or investor pool, which tends to keep inventory tighter and turnover more deliberate. For a buyer, that means less pressure to compete against a flood of listings at once; for a seller, it means your comps are likely a handful of similarly-aged homes rather than a large, uniform batch.

A Neighborhood Built in Layers
At 319 homes, this is a sizable but not sprawling pocket. The median living area of 1,890 square feet points to homes sized for practical, everyday living rather than oversized new construction, and the wide year-built range means buyers should expect real variation in systems, roofs, and layouts from one listing to the next.
No community amenities are identified from current MLS listings, so this isn't a neighborhood selling itself on a clubhouse or pool. The value case here is the home and the location within St Petersburg itself, not a shared amenity package — worth knowing before you compare it against a planned community with HOA-run facilities.
